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car from the Muranska Planina National Park, head south on the main road (E571) towards the town of Tisovec. Continue for approximately 20 kilometers until you reach the town. Once in Tisovec, follow the signs to the city center. The Múzeum ozubnicovej železnice is located at Hviezdoslavova 433, which should be easily reachable from the main road. Parking is available nearby.

  • Public Transportation

    For those using public transportation, you can take a bus from the nearest town within Muranska Planina National Park to Tisovec. Check local bus schedules for routes heading to Tisovec. Once you arrive at the Tisovec bus station, the museum is about a 15-minute walk. Head northeast on Mierová Street, turn left onto Špitálska Street, and continue straight until you reach Hviezdoslavova Street. The museum will be on your right. Always check the latest bus schedules, as they can vary.

Discover more about Múzeum ozubnicovej železnice Tisovec

Nestled in the picturesque town of Tisovec, the Museum of Cog Railway is a captivating destination that brings the fascinating history of Slovakia's cog railways to life. This charming museum is dedicated to showcasing the engineering marvels that once traversed the mountainous terrain, making it a must-visit for both history buffs and railway enthusiasts. Visitors can explore an impressive collection of vintage locomotives, historical photographs, and informative displays that tell the story of the cog railway's significance in the region's development. The museum's friendly staff are eager to share their knowledge, providing insights into the operational techniques and challenges faced by early railway workers. The museum is designed to be both educational and entertaining, making it suitable for visitors of all ages. You can easily spend a few hours wandering through the exhibits, with opportunities to take memorable photographs alongside the beautifully restored trains. The museum is open daily, ensuring flexibility in your travel plans. If you find yourself in the area, don't miss the chance to immerse yourself in this unique aspect of Slovakia's heritage, where the allure of steam and steel meets the breathtaking backdrop of the surrounding Carpathian Mountains.
